1、设计模式是什么? 你知道哪些设计模式,并简要叙述? 2、MVC 和 MVVM 的区别 3、#import跟 #...[作者空间]
这个栏目将持续更新--请iOS的小伙伴关注! (答案不唯一,仅供参考,欢迎留言,文章最后有福利) iOS面试题大全...[作者空间]
前言 什么是内存管理?是指软件运行时对计算机内存资源的分配和使用的技术。其最主要的目的是如何高效,快速的分配,并且...[作者空间]
技 术 文 章 / 超 人 个人觉得要更加深入直观了解MRC与ARC的区别建议先从内存分析开始所以文章开始会从内存...[作者空间]
花絮:从上一篇文章的发表到这篇文章的发表已经有很长一段时间了,一直在摸索适合自己的学习方式,到现在还是没有找到适合...[作者空间]
下面的代码输出什么? @implementationSon:Father -(id)init { self=[su...[作者空间]
KVC(key-value coding) 概要 KVC允许开发者通过名字访问属性,无需调用明确的存取方法,这样开...[作者空间]
总结下 @synthesize 合成实例变量的规则,有以下几点: 如果指定了成员变量的名称,会生成一个指定的名称的...[作者空间]
objc_msgSend()是[obj foo]的具体实现。在runtime中,objc_msgSend()是一个...[作者空间]
NSString,NSArray这些类拥有Mutable的子类。当你给属性赋值的时候,用的是不可变类型,其实str...[作者空间]
现在开发中,基本是使用ARC(自动引用计数)技术,来编写我们的代码。因此在属性property中我们经常使用的关键...[作者空间]
synthesize,编译器自动生成setter和getter的方法,在你没有手动去实现这两个方法时。dynami...[作者空间]
iOS面试 Model层: 数据持久化存储方案有哪些? 沙盒的目录结构是怎样的?各自一般用于什么场合?- Appl...[作者空间]
前言 前面发了一篇iOS 面试的文章,在说到 UIView 和 CALayer 的区别和联系的时候,被喵神指出没有...[作者空间]
Part One 别人问你你都感觉这尼玛说啥的基础面试题 1.UIWindow和UIView和 CALayer 的...[作者空间]